When prompted, type your administrator password. If the volume has a different name, replace MyVolume in the command with the name of your volume. Each command assumes that the installer is in your Applications folder, and MyVolume is the name of the USB flash drive or other volume you're using. Type or paste one of the commands below into Terminal, then press Return to enter the command. Open Terminal, which is in the Utilities folder of your Applications folder. Plug in the USB flash drive or other volume that you're using for the bootable installer.

  • Download macOS Use Terminal to create the bootable installer 1.
  • Download from a Mac that is compatible with the macOS you're downloading. Enterprise administrators: download from Apple, not a locally hosted update server.
  • Installer for OS X El Capitan or later. To get the full installer, your Mac must be using the latest version of OS X El Capitan, the latest version of macOS Sierra, or any later version of macOS.
  • USB flash drive or other secondary volume with at least 14GB of available storage, formatted as Mac OS Extended.

    In fact, it is still very easy to create a USB installation disk for OS X Lion. Starting with OS X Lion, the only way to get new software will be to download and install it through the Mac App store.įortunately, it does not appear that Apple has limited our ability to create our own installation media for OS X installations. No longer would you be able to buy the latest and greatest software from Apple on DVDs or other media. When Apple announced at their World Wide Developers Conference the release of OS X Lion, they shared that they were moving forward with a new way to distribute software to their customers.
